镖师 发表于 2022-9-5 20:16:35

怎么修改登录界面窗口的尺寸?

怎么修改这个窗口的尺寸?
我知道答案 回答被采纳将会获得5 金币 已有0人回答

Discuz智能体 发表于 2025-3-16 17:34:00

要修改Discuz登录界面窗口的尺寸,你可以通过修改模板文件或CSS样式来实现。以下是具体的步骤:

### 1. 修改模板文件
登录界面的模板文件通常位于 `template/default/member/login.htm` 或你当前使用的模板目录下的 `member/login.htm` 文件中。

1. 找到并打开 `login.htm` 文件。
2. 在文件中找到登录窗口的HTML代码,通常是一个 `<div>` 元素,可能带有 `class` 或 `id` 属性,例如 `class="login-box"` 或 `id="login-box"`。
3. 修改该 `<div>` 元素的 `width` 和 `height` 属性,或者直接在 `<div>` 标签中添加 `style` 属性来设置宽度和高度。

例如:
<div id="login-box" style="width: 400px; height: 300px;">
    <!-- 登录表单内容 -->
</div>

### 2. 修改CSS样式
如果你不想直接修改HTML文件,可以通过修改CSS样式来调整登录窗口的尺寸。

1. 找到并打开 `template/default/common/common.css` 或你当前使用的模板目录下的 `common.css` 文件。
2. 在CSS文件中找到与登录窗口相关的样式,通常是通过 `class` 或 `id` 选择器来定义的。
3. 修改 `width` 和 `height` 属性来调整窗口尺寸。

例如:
#login-box {
    width: 400px;
    height: 300px;
}

### 3. 使用JavaScript动态调整
如果你希望根据用户的操作动态调整登录窗口的尺寸,可以使用JavaScript来实现。

1. 在 `login.htm` 文件中找到登录窗口的 `<div>` 元素。
2. 使用JavaScript代码来动态修改该元素的尺寸。

例如:
<div id="login-box">
    <!-- 登录表单内容 -->
</div>
<script>
    document.getElementById('login-box').style.width = '400px';
    document.getElementById('login-box').style.height = '300px';
</script>

### 4. 清除缓存
修改完成后,记得清除Discuz的缓存,以便修改生效。你可以在Discuz后台的“工具” -> “更新缓存”中进行操作。

### 注意事项
- 在修改模板文件或CSS样式之前,建议先备份相关文件,以防止出现意外情况。
- 如果你使用的是第三方模板,可能需要根据模板的具体结构进行调整。

通过以上步骤,你应该能够成功修改Discuz登录界面窗口的尺寸。如果你有其他问题,欢迎继续提问!
-- 本回答由 人工智能 AI智能体 生成,内容仅供参考,请仔细甄别。
页: [1]
查看完整版本: 怎么修改登录界面窗口的尺寸?